Ophthalmic manifestation after SARS-CoV-2 vaccination: a case series

Abstract: Background The aim of this report is to describe ocular side effects in patients who received one of the two COVID-19 vaccines – Astra Zeneca or Pfizer-Biontech and to contribute to the common understanding of the COVID-19 vaccination process. Results Three patients reactivated underlying herpetic disease and developed uveitis and keratitis. Two of them were vaccinated with Pfizer and one was with Astra Zeneca. “…We read with interest the article by Murgova et al about five patients with ophthalmologic complications after a SARS-CoV-2 vaccination [ 1 ]. Patient-1 experienced right herpetic keratitis and iridocyclitis, patient-2 left anterior uveitis, patient-3 retinal detachment, retinal necrosis, and vitritis, patient-4 anterior ischemic optic neuropathy (AION), and patient-5 left ptosis after subarachnoid bleeding (SAB) (Table 1 ) [ 1 ]. The study is promising but raises concerns that should be discussed.…”
